(Case C‑410/06)

Failure of Member State to fulfil obligations – Directive 2002/15/EC – Organisation of the working time of persons performing mobile road transport activities – Failure to transpose within the period prescribed

Re:

Failure of Member State to fulfil obligations – Failure to take within the prescribed period the necessary measures to comply with Directive 2002/15/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 11 March 2002 on the organisation of the working time of persons performing mobile road transport activities (OJ 2002 L 80, p. 35).

Operative part

The Court:

Declares that, by failing to adopt within the period prescribed all the laws regulations and administrative provisions necessary to comply with Directive 2002/15/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 11 March 2002 on the organisation of the working time of persons performing mobile road transport activities, the Portuguese Republic has failed to fulfil its obligations under that directive;

Orders the Portuguese Republic to pay the costs.
